There aren’t many UK casinos that build their entire identity around mobile play, or at least attempt to do so. The Phone Casino does just that – and it leaves you with particular expectations. If you’ve been curious about what sets it apart from more mainstream names, this review should help you figure out if it’s worth your time.
The Phone Casino has been operating under Small Screen Casinos Ltd since the early 2010s, built with a mobile-first mindset. The company itself has been licensed in the UK since 2006, giving it one of the longer uninterrupted runs among smaller operators.
Compared to full-service casinos with hundreds of partnerships and rotating offers, The Phone Casino operates on a smaller scale. It also shares a layout and a lot of its features with its sister sites, nothing too unique of its own.

Legally, they have everything sorted. There have been no fines, no licence breaches, and no red flags from regulators.
The Phone Casino has a visual style that uses colour more which helps it stand apart from the usual grey-heavy layout.
That said, the colour combination feels mismatched and a bit rough around the edges. Space isn’t utilised the best way here, large margins sit unused while key content huddles in the centre.
Some of the visual decisions might not be great for all players too. When you open the banking section for one, the entire page shifts to the left. And when you open the menu, the main screen gets folded out.
When I first opened the site I was met by a spinning icon which wouldn’t disappear. This issue was resolved when disabling my ad blocker, it must’ve been an issue with cookies.

Despite the minimalistic structure, useful links are scattered across the page instead. Important sections like promotions or support sit near the bottom or inside side panels, which means extra scrolling.
Sign up was rather easy, you just need to fill 2 pages. I didn’t like that registration is on a screen on the right-hand side, it looks better when it’s in the middle of the screen.
I also couldn’t set my password during sign up. Turns out it’s automatically set to the last four digits of your mobile number and you can change it when you login.
This one is also among the only site’s I’ve seen where you log in with your phone number rather than a username or email address.
I also wasn’t a fan that you had to accept the marketing preferences to create your account. To be fair, you can change that after but the aftertaste remains.

It’s strange to see a casino that puts such a strong focus on phones skip having a proper app. We checked both Android and iOS stores, but nothing came up. Instead, the only option is using your browser.
I opened the site through Chrome and signed in without trouble, though the homepage didn’t leave a great first feeling.
The layout felt messy. Elements sat unevenly on the screen, and some menus didn’t quite line up. It gave the whole site an unfinished look. Loading between sections was even slower than on desktop, simple actions like going from the main page to the account tab took a noticeable few seconds longer than necessary.
Surprisingly, games held up better than the rest. They launched quickly and played without stutters. I didn’t run into any technical issues while trying a few titles, which made the contrast with the rest of the interface more noticeable. The performance deserved a better frame than the one it had.

There’s a lot to unpack here. The Phone Casino pushes past expectations when it comes to its game library – more than 3,200 titles. That said, the deposit system is beginner-friendly, with a minimum top-up of just £3 for card users. Withdrawals, however, aren’t as welcoming.
The advertised no deposit bonus is just access to a public slot tournament, not actual spins. There’s also not many deals for an average user. No live chat is also a major letdown. We’d say this one’s for those who care more about a deep game library and basic casino things. If that’s what matters to you, it might be worth a closer look.
